拿阿里云MongoDB举例
Keys:mongoexport,mongoimport
导出:
示例:1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17mongoexport -h dds-********.mongodb.rds.aliyuncs.com:3717 --authenticationDatabase admin -u root -p **** -d ranger -c players -o players.json -q '{id: {"$in": [16398, 10001]}}'
mongoexport -h dds-********.mongodb.rds.aliyuncs.com:3717 --authenticationDatabase admin -u root -p **** -d pigcome -c dollOrders -o orders.csv -q '{orderId: {"$gte": 1}}' --type csv -f uid,orderId,dollId,name,weChat,phone,address,mark,status
mongoexport -h 10.10.100.100:27017 --authenticationDatabase admin -u mongouser -p ******** -d **** -c robots -o robot.json
参数说明:
-h MongoDB服务器地址
--authenticationDatabase 验证角色数据库
-u 登录帐号
-p 登录密码
-d 连接数据库
-c 默认集合
-o 导出文件名
-q 查询语句
-type 导出类型
-f 导出字段导入:
示例:1
2
3
4
5
6
7
8
9mongoimport -h dds-m5e7bc768a732d041.mongodb.rds.aliyuncs.com:3717 --authenticationDatabase admin -u root -p ******** -d ranger -c players players.json
参数说明:
-h MongoDB服务器地址
--authenticationDatabase 验证角色数据库
-u 登录帐号
-p 登录密码
-d 连接数据库
-c 默认集合